Location:
- The Kolaramma Temple is located in the heart of Kolar town, Karnataka, India.
- The exact address is Fort Area, Kolar, Karnataka 563101, India.
- The temple is easily accessible by bus, auto-rickshaw, or private vehicle.
Timings:
- Main Temple:
- Opens daily from 6:00 AM to 9:00 PM.
- Pooja Timings:
- Ushakala Pooja (Morning Pooja): 6:00 AM – 7:00 AM.
- Maha Mangalarathi: 7:30 PM.
- Ekantha Seva Pooja: 8:30 PM.
- The temple closes at 9:00 PM.
Opening Days:
- The Kolaramma Temple is open every day of the year.
Best Time to Visit:
- The best time to visit the Kolaramma Temple is during the early mornings (6:00 AM – 8:00 AM) or evenings (6:00 PM – 8:00 PM) when the temple is less crowded.
- The festivals of Karthika Deepam, Ugadi, and Navaratri are also considered auspicious times to visit the temple, but be prepared for larger crowds.

Amazing Facts about the Temple:
- The Kolaramma Temple is believed to be around 1,000 years old, dating back to the Chola dynasty.
- The temple is built in the Dravidian style of architecture, characterized by its tall towers (gopurams) and intricate carvings.
- The deity Kolaramma is considered an incarnation of Goddess Shakti and is worshipped for her blessings of prosperity, health, and happiness.
- The temple complex also houses a holy tank (theertha) and several smaller shrines dedicated to other deities.
- The temple is a popular pilgrimage site and attracts devotees from all over India.
